    "What practices are off limits for debt collectors?"

    False statements. Debt collectors may not lie when they are trying to collect a debt. For example, they may not:

      falsely claim that they are attorneys or government representatives;
      falsely claim that you have committed a crime;

    Debt collectors also are prohibited from saying that:

      you will be arrested if you don’t pay your debt;

    "Do I have any recourse if I think a debt collector has violated the law?"

    You have the right to sue a collector in a state or federal court within one year from the date the law was violated. If you win, the judge can require the collector to pay you for any damages you can prove you suffered because of the illegal collection practices, like lost wages and medical bills. The judge can require the debt collector to pay you up to $1,000, even if you can’t prove that you suffered actual damages. You also can be reimbursed for your attorney’s fees and court costs. A group of people also may sue a debt collector as part of a class action lawsuit and recover money for damages up to $500,000, or one percent of the collector’s net worth, whichever amount is lower. Even if a debt collector violates the FDCPA in trying to collect a debt, the debt does not go away if you owe it.
